当前位置:主页 > 科技论文 > 计算机论文 >

并行重构系统中的全局流分析

发布时间:2020-11-11 09:50
   为了更好地利用多处理机系统提供的高性能,并行编译(重构)系统已成为多处理机系统必不可少的组成部分。依赖分析是并行重构的核心,而全局流分析直接影响着依赖分析的精确度,并影响着多种优化策略和并行转换的策略及效率。本文阐述了并行编译前端中控制流、数据流分析的原理及经典算法,并介绍了中科院计算所并行编译组所研制的并行优化重构工具PORT中实用的全局流分析GFA。GFA借鉴了其它并行重构系统的优点,将控制依赖转换为数据依赖并化简控制表达式,从而消除GOTO语句,可以并行含IF语句的DO循环;同是它也具有独到之处:实现了许多并行编译器所回避的精确的过程间数据流分析,对公用区采用独到的处理办法,可以并行含CALL语句的DO循环;采用优化的算法以降低时间代价;采用一些技巧以降低空间开销;扩展了许多并行编译器所不具备的功能(例如求标量易名链)。因此,它是一个实用的、精确的、全局的、扩展的流分析。本文着眼于它的组成、实现及所采用的先进技术。在文章的最后,对并行编译的前景进行了展望。
【学位单位】:中国科学院研究生院(计算技术研究所)
【学位级别】:硕士
【学位年份】:1994
【中图分类】:TP338.6
【文章目录】:
致谢
摘要
abstract
第一章 绪论
第二章 并行重构系统
    §2.1 多处理机
    §2.2 并行重构系统
第三章 流分析
    §3.1 基本术语
    §3.2 程序模式
    §3.3 过程内控制流分析
        §3.3.1 基本块划分
        §3.3.2 控制流图的产生
        §3.3.3 必经结点集
        §3.3.4 循环
        §3.3.5 可归约流图
        §3.3.6 深度优先树
        §3.3.7 控制依赖
    §3.4 过程内数据流分析
        §3.4.1 引用定值链
        §3.4.2 定值引用链
        §3.4.3 数组元素的定值引用链
        §3.4.4 数据流问题的分类
    §3.5 过程间数据流分析
        §3.5.1 不敏感于控制流的分析
        §3.5.2 敏感于控制流的分析
    §3.6 数据流分析的应用
第四章 PORT中实用的全局流分析
    §4.1 运行环境
    §4.2 实现
        §4.2.1 总框图
        §4.2.2 控制流分析
        §4.2.3 数据流分析
    §4.3 全局流分析在PORT系统中的应用情况
    §4.4 全局流分析在软件工程环境中的其他应用
第五章 结束语
参考文献
履历

【相似文献】

相关期刊论文 前10条

1 胡道元;;清华大学引进ELXSI6400计算机[J];实验技术与管理;1987年03期

2 ;[J];;年期

3 ;[J];;年期

4 ;[J];;年期

5 ;[J];;年期

6 ;[J];;年期

7 ;[J];;年期

8 ;[J];;年期

9 ;[J];;年期

10 ;[J];;年期


相关博士学位论文 前4条

1 黄金贵;网络并行计算环境中基于多处理机任务的调度研究[D];中南大学;2003年

2 阳春华;工业实时系统多任务容错调度技术及应用研究[D];中南大学;2002年

3 孙玉强;并行语法分析中几类算法的设计与研究[D];西安电子科技大学;2008年

4 张艳;分布并行算法设计、分析与实现[D];电子科技大学;2001年


相关硕士学位论文 前10条

1 吉晓梅;并行重构系统中的全局流分析[D];中国科学院研究生院(计算技术研究所);1994年

2 耿玮;基于锁感知的多处理机VCPU调度系统[D];华中科技大学;2011年

3 高彦明;蚁群算法并行化研究[D];苏州大学;2005年

4 周向东;基于偶图匹配的多处理机任务调度启发算法[D];郑州大学;2000年

5 潘吉斯;一种Bayesian网络结构的并行学习方法[D];苏州大学;2006年

6 于伶;机群环境下的并行小波分析[D];黑龙江大学;2005年

7 王辉;改进了的RMS与EDF以及两者的混合调度算法[D];吉林大学;2004年

8 师政毅;基于动态容错机制的数据传输实时任务分配与调度技术[D];长春理工大学;2010年

9 刘嘉诚;关于同类机半在线排序问题的若干研究[D];郑州大学;2007年

10 郑涛;解抛物型方程的并行算法及其并行实现[D];吉林大学;2009年



本文编号:2879047

资料下载
论文发表

本文链接:https://www.wllwen.com/kejilunwen/jisuanjikexuelunwen/2879047.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户467fb***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com